Trip includes
- 7 days, 6 nights accommodations, based on double occupancy.
- Daily Breakfast.
- Chef’s Tasting Dinner on first night of arrival. Wine/ beverages not included.
- 3 cooking classes, followed by lunch or dinner on the foods prepared in class; wine, water and dessert included.
- Rialto Market Visit before one cooking class.
- Campo Santa Margherita Guided Tour with Afternoon Tea (2 hrs with private guide).
- Murano Glass Excursion-transfer to Island included, with guide for the tour at the artisan glass maker. (4-Hour Lagoon private tour can be added-on at a surcharge).
- Walking Tour ‘Venice Writer’s, Poets & Literati’ (3 hr walking tour with private guide).
- Arrival & Departure transfers from Venice Santa Lucia Train Station with hostess on arrival.
- Welcome Bag featuring Cooking Apron, hand-made journal and recipe booklet.
- All taxes and Italian VAT included.

Accommodation
Live like a Venetian and step back in time at the privately-owned villa hotel in the heart of Venice. The 17th century villa, nestled on a quiet waterway just off the Grand Canal, is a very short walk from the Accademia Bridge & vaporetto stop. Check in to your lovely & spacious bedroom; furnished with Venetian antiques, and modern comforts such as ac/heat, mini bar, International TV, private bath, heated towel rack, in-room wireless internet at a surcharge, and a famed Canal view (upon request). A diligent & professional staff is at your service and ready to assist and answer any of your questions. An expansive daily breakfast is served in the elegantly appointed breakfast room that overlooks the garden and waterway. Walk out your door and into the heart of Venice.
The villa hotel sits in one of the most beautiful areas of Venice, and steps away from the Accademia Museum and Campo St. Margherita. Step outside and pass by small bookshops, tiny trattorias, wine bars, and artisan shops filled with Murano glass. The open-air market on Campo St. Margherita is lined with cafés spilling to its center. The Accademia Bridge, 1 of 3 bridges that cross the Grand Canal, is a 2-minute walk from the hotel.
